#include "allocation.h"
#include "mock_machine.h"
#include "test.h"
/* ======== hw_alloc_reset_cos ======== */
static void
test_hw_alloc_reset_cos(void **state __attribute__((unused)))
{
int ret;
unsigned msr_start = 0xf0;
unsigned msr_num = 3;
unsigned coreid = 1;
unsigned msr_val = 0xf;
unsigned i;
for (i = 0; i < msr_num; ++i) {
expect_value(__wrap_msr_write, lcore, coreid);
expect_value(__wrap_msr_write, reg, msr_start + i);
expect_value(__wrap_msr_write, value, msr_val);
will_return(__wrap_msr_write, PQOS_RETVAL_OK);
}
ret = hw_alloc_reset_cos(msr_start, msr_num, coreid, msr_val);
assert_int_equal(ret, PQOS_RETVAL_OK);
}
int
main(void)
{
int result = 0;
const struct CMUnitTest tests[] = {
cmocka_unit_test(test_hw_alloc_reset_cos)};
result += cmocka_run_group_tests(tests, test_init_l3ca, test_fini);
return result;
}
